Understanding Cholesterol and Its Role in Health

Cholesterol often gets a bad rap, but it’s essential for many bodily functions. It’s a waxy, fat-like substance found in every cell, vital for producing hormones, vitamin D, and bile acids that aid digestion. The body manufactures cholesterol naturally, but it also comes from dietary sources, primarily animal products.

Cholesterol travels through the bloodstream via lipoproteins—mainly low-density lipoprotein (LDL) and high-density lipoprotein (HDL). LDL is frequently dubbed “bad cholesterol” because high levels can lead to plaque buildup in arteries. HDL is considered “good cholesterol” as it helps remove excess cholesterol from the bloodstream.

When discussing diets like the carnivore diet, understanding how they influence these lipoprotein levels is crucial. Since this diet emphasizes animal-based foods rich in saturated fats and cholesterol, its impact on blood lipid profiles is complex and varies widely.

What Is the Carnivore Diet?

The carnivore diet is an extreme elimination diet that involves consuming only animal products—meat, fish, eggs, and some dairy—while excluding all plant-based foods. Followers claim benefits like weight loss, improved mental clarity, and reduced inflammation.

This diet is ultra-low in carbohydrates and high in protein and fat. Unlike ketogenic or low-carb diets that allow some plant-based foods, the carnivore diet cuts out fiber entirely. This approach drastically changes macronutrient intake and can influence metabolism profoundly.

Since cholesterol intake increases significantly on this diet due to high consumption of red meat and organ meats, many wonder about its effects on blood cholesterol levels.

How Does The Carnivore Diet Affect Cholesterol Levels?

The relationship between dietary cholesterol intake and blood cholesterol levels isn’t straightforward. For decades, dietary guidelines warned against eating too much saturated fat or cholesterol to avoid heart disease risk. However, recent research challenges this notion by showing that dietary cholesterol has a smaller impact on blood cholesterol than once thought.

On the carnivore diet:

    • LDL Cholesterol: Some people experience elevated LDL levels after switching to this diet. This rise can be substantial for “hyper-responders,” whose bodies produce more LDL particles when consuming more saturated fats.
    • HDL Cholesterol: HDL often increases alongside LDL on the carnivore diet. A higher HDL level is generally protective against cardiovascular disease.
    • Triglycerides: Many report decreased triglyceride levels due to very low carbohydrate intake.

The net effect depends heavily on individual genetics, baseline health status, and lifestyle factors such as exercise.

The Role of LDL Particle Size

Not all LDL particles are created equal. Small dense LDL particles are more atherogenic—they penetrate artery walls easily and promote plaque formation. Larger fluffy LDL particles are less harmful.

Studies show that low-carb diets like the carnivore tend to increase large buoyant LDL particles rather than small dense ones. This shift may reduce cardiovascular risk despite higher total LDL numbers.

Inflammation Markers Matter Too

Cholesterol numbers alone don’t tell the whole story about heart disease risk. Inflammation plays a critical role in artery damage and plaque instability.

Some followers of the carnivore diet report reduced markers of systemic inflammation such as C-reactive protein (CRP). This reduction could offset concerns about raised LDL by improving overall vascular health.

The Impact of Weight Loss on Cholesterol Changes

Many individuals who adopt the carnivore diet experience rapid weight loss initially due to carb restriction and reduced calorie intake from satiety effects of protein.

Weight loss itself can drastically alter lipid profiles:

    • Total Cholesterol: Often decreases with sustained weight loss but may transiently rise during rapid fat mobilization.
    • LDL Levels: May temporarily spike as fat stores release stored cholesterol into circulation.
    • HDL Levels: Usually increase with improved metabolic health.

Therefore, shifts in cholesterol seen during early phases of the carnivore diet might reflect weight loss dynamics rather than direct dietary effects alone.

Liver Function’s Role in Cholesterol Regulation

The liver produces most circulating cholesterol according to body needs. On a zero-carb carnivore regimen, changes in liver metabolism occur:

    • The liver burns more fat-derived ketones for energy instead of glucose.
    • This metabolic switch can alter how much cholesterol the liver synthesizes or clears from circulation.
    • Liver enzymes often normalize or improve with elimination of processed carbs and sugars common in standard diets.

Better liver function may contribute to healthier lipid profiles despite high dietary cholesterol intake.

The Debate: Is Elevated Cholesterol Always Dangerous?

Elevated LDL has been traditionally linked with heart disease risk through decades of epidemiological data. However:

    • The context matters: high LDL combined with low HDL and high triglycerides signals higher risk than isolated elevated LDL with good HDL/triglyceride ratios.
    • A subset of people have genetically higher LDL but no increased cardiovascular events (“benign hypercholesterolemia”).
    • The quality of lipoproteins—their size and oxidation state—is crucial beyond just quantity measures.

Thus, an increase in total or even LDL cholesterol after adopting a carnivore diet doesn’t automatically mean greater heart disease risk without considering these nuances.
